Ssangyong KEV2
Fri, 01 Apr 2011Continuing Ssangyong's revival is another new car from the Korean company, the KEV2. Unveiled at the Seoul Motor Show, the KEV2 is an electric version of the company's outgoing Korando model. However, in the pursuit of diversifying the aesthetic between drivetrains, the KEV2 features a new DRG that sees the conventional grille lost and more aggressive, taught LED headlights replace the existing lamps.

Mini Beachcomber Concept at Detroit motor show 2010
Tue, 15 Dec 2009This funky beach-biased concept car has just appeared at the 2010 Detroit Auto Show in January. Called the Mini Beachcomber Concept, this flight-of-fancy Moke-inspired show car gives us our first glimpse of how Mini's production-spec 4x4 crossover will look at launch - we'll see the real car at the Geneva motor show in March 2010 ahead of an autumn UK launch. This four-seater, four-wheel-drive machine has been designed without doors or a conventional roof, so that its occupants are not cut off from the outside world.
